Uma iyunithi yokuqandisa isikulufu isiqalisiwe, into yokuqala okufanele uyazi ukuthi uhlelo lokuqandisa lusebenza kahle yini. Okulandelayo isingeniso esifushane kokuqukethwe kanye nezimpawu zokusebenza okuvamile, futhi okulandelayo kungokwereferensi kuphela:
Amanzi okupholisa e-condenser kufanele anele, ingcindezi yamanzi kufanele ibe ngaphezu kuka-0.12MPa, futhi izinga lokushisa lamanzi akufanele libe phezulu kakhulu.
Kumayunithi okuqandisa izikulufo, ukufundwa kwesilinganiso sokucindezela kwephampu kawoyela kufanele kube ngu-0.15~0.3MPa ngaphezu kokucindezela kokukhipha umoya.

Ngaphansi kwanoma yiziphi izimo, izinga lokushisa likawoyela akufanele lidlule u-70°C weyunithi yokuqandisa i-fluorine kanye no-65°C wefriji ye-ammonia, futhi okungenani akufanele kube ngaphansi kuka-30°C. Ngaphansi kwezimo zokusebenza ezijwayelekile, uwoyela wokugcoba akufanele uphole (ngaphandle kweyunithi yokuqandisa i-fluorine).
Izinga lokushisa lokukhipha igesi esiqandisini. I-Ammonia ne-R22 azidluli ku-135°C, futhi uma izinga lokushisa legesi ekhipha umoya likhuphuka kakhulu, lizoba lincane kakhulu uma liqhathaniswa ne-flash point kawoyela oqandisini (160°C), okuyinto engalungile emishinini. Ngakho-ke, ngokombono wokusetshenziswa, izinga lokushisa lokukhipha umoya akufanele libe phezulu kakhulu, futhi uma liphezulu kakhulu, kufanele limiswe ukuze kutholakale isizathu.
Izinga lokucindezela kokujiya. Ngokuyinhloko kunqunywa ngokuya ngomthombo wamanzi, isakhiwo se-condenser kanye nesiqandisi esisetshenziswayo. Izinga loketshezi lwedamu akufanele libe ngaphansi kwengxenye eyodwa kwezintathu zesibonakaliso sezinga loketshezi, futhi izinga likawoyela le-crankcase akufanele libe ngaphansi komugqa ophakathi ovundlile wefasitela lesibonakaliso.
Ipayipi lokubuyisela uwoyela elizenzakalelayo le-fluorine oil separator livamile uma libanda futhi lishisa, kanti umjikelezo obandayo noshisayo cishe uyihora eli-1. Akufanele kube nomehluko ocacile wokushisa ngaphambi nangemva kwesihlungi sepayipi eliwuketshezi. Akufanele kube khona ukuqandisa, ngaphandle kwalokho kuzovinjwa. Isiqandisi se-fluorine kufanele sipholile ohlangothini oluyisicaba futhi sishise ohlangothini olomile. Amalunga esistimu ye-fluorine akufanele avuza uwoyela, okusho ukuthi ukuvuza kwe-fluorine.
Uma uthinta i-condenser evundlile ngesikhathi sokusebenza, ingxenye engenhla kufanele ishise kanti ingxenye engezansi kufanele iphole. Indawo ehlangana kuyo ebandayo neshisayo yizinga loketshezi lwesiqandisi. Isihlukanisi samafutha naso sishisa engxenyeni engenhla, kanti ingxenye engezansi ayishisi kakhulu. I-valve yokuphepha noma i-valve ye-bypass yesiqandisi kufanele izwakale ipholile ekugcineni kokucindezela okuphansi, uma ingapholile, kusho ukuvuza komoya okuphezulu nokuphansi kokucindezela.
Ngesikhathi sokusebenza, ingcindezi yomusi kufanele ifane nengcindezi yokumunca, kanti ingcindezi yokukhipha umoya ekugcineni kwengcindezi ephezulu kufanele ifane nengcindezi yokujiya kanye nengcindezi yesamukeli soketshezi. Uma kungenjalo, akuvamile.
Ngaphansi kwesilinganiso esithile sokugeleza kwamanzi, kufanele kube nomehluko wokushisa phakathi kokungena nokukhipha kwamanzi abandayo. Uma kungekho mehluko wokushisa noma umehluko omncane kakhulu wokushisa, kusho ukuthi indawo yokudlulisa ukushisa yemishini yokushintshanisa ukushisa ingcolile futhi idinga ukuvalwa ukuze ihlanzwe.
Isiqandisi ngokwaso kufanele sivalwe futhi akufanele sivuze isiqandisi namafutha okugcoba. Ukuze kuvikelwe ishaft, uma umthamo ojwayelekile wokupholisa ungu-12.6 × 1000 kJ/h, uphawu lweshaft luvunyelwe ukuba nokuvuza okuncane kwamafutha, kanti isiqandisi esinamandla okupholisa ajwayelekile > 12.6 × 1000 kJ/h asivunyelwe ukuba namaconsi angaphezu kwe-10 okuvuza kwamafutha ngehora. Izinga lokushisa le-shaft seal kanye ne-bearing yesiqandisi akufanele lidlule ku-70°C.
Iqhwa noma amazolo ku-valve yokwandisa kuyafana, kodwa iqhwa elikhulu akufanele livele endaweni yokungena.
